How to Apply for Boulder, Colorado Water Rebates

Boulder Water customers pay $1.00/sq ft for professional turf removal (city covers $1.75/sq ft up to $750). Minimum 200 sq ft. Pre-approval required — apply before removing any grass. Slots fill by mid-season; apply early in the calendar year.

Application Steps

  1. 1

    Apply online at resourcecentral.org before removing any grass

    Go to resourcecentral.org/lawn/apply/ and select City of Boulder as your water provider. Submit measurements and photos of the project area along with your recent water bill showing your account number. Pre-approval is mandatory — removing turf before receiving written authorization disqualifies your project.

  2. 2

    Get approved and pay the 50% deposit to schedule

    Resource Central reviews applications on a rolling basis starting in spring. Once approved (typically starting May), you receive an invitation to schedule your removal appointment. A 50% deposit is required to reserve your date. The city's subsidy is applied at this stage — you pay $1.00/sqft, not $2.75/sqft.

  3. 3

    Crew removes turf and hauls it away

    On your scheduled appointment day, a Resource Central crew arrives with sod-cutting equipment, removes the turf, and hauls it to composting. You do not need to arrange separate equipment or disposal.

  4. 4

    Plant at least 50% water-wise plants within 6 months

    Within 6 months of the turf removal, the converted area must be planted with at least 50% water-wise, drought-tolerant plant material appropriate for the Colorado Front Range. Bare soil does not satisfy this requirement. Resource Central can provide plant guidance.

Apply before removing any turf — pre-approval is required and retroactive applications are not accepted. Slots fill during the spring enrollment window; apply as early in the year as possible (last verified May 2026, resourcecentral.org and bouldercolorado.gov).
